Article: Amerigon's voice-activated navigation system a hit at Consumer Electronics Show.

MONROVIA, Calif.--(BUSINESS WIRE)--Jan. 13, 1995--Amerigon Inc. (NASDAQ:ARGNA) Friday announced that its AudioNav, a voice-interactive automobile navigation system, received strong interest at the Winter Consumer Electronics Show in Las Vegas last week.

As previously announced, the AudioNav was showcased by four leading electronics and audio manufacturers to introduce customers to the latest technology and products. The four companies were Alpine, Clarion, Fujitsu Ten's Eclipse and Kenwood.
